gold spangle vs Orange Nectar Bat

Autographa bractea compared with Lonchophylla robusta

Taxonomic Classification

Rank gold spangle Orange Nectar Bat
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Arthropoda (Arthropods)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Insecta (Insects)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) Chiroptera (Bats)
Family Noctuidae Phyllostomidae
Genus Autographa Lonchophylla
Species Autographa bractea Lonchophylla robusta

Evolutionary Relationship

gold spangle and Orange Nectar Bat share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
